African Commission
-
North Africa

ACHPR Rapporteur Calls for Lasting Solution to Sahrawi Refugee Crisis
The Special Rapporteur on Refugees, Asylum Seekers, Internally Displaced Persons, and Migrants in Africa, Salma Sassi, expressed deep appreciation for…
Read More » -
Africa

Africans Need a Strong Commission to Address the Challenges Facing the Continent
The Algerian Minister of State, Minister of Foreign Affairs, National Community Abroad and African Affairs, Ahmed Attaf, emphasized that “all…
Read More »

